Put dry ingredients in pan.
Beat eggs separately.
Add to dry ingredients.
Add milk, stirring in a little at a time to avoid lumps.
Set pan in boiling water (double boiler).
Stir until it thickens.
Test on a wooden spoon.
Coats spoon when done.
Use a drop of yellow food coloring to add color and add vanilla.
Do not let it curd, but cook until it coats wooden spoon.
